Understanding Task Dispatching in MetaTrader 5
In a trading context, task dispatching involves assigning and executing different tasks that need to be carried out by the platform for optimal operation. These tasks can range from real-time data processing to sending trade orders and managing existing positions.The role that task dispatching plays in MetaTrader 5 cannot be overstated; it is the backbone of executing trading strategies efficiently. When done correctly, it ensures that market opportunities are captured instantaneously, risks are managed proactively, and traders’ instructions are executed without unnecessary delays or errors.
Challenges Faced in Task Management on MetaTrader 5
Despite its advanced capabilities, managing tasks on MT5 can present challenges even to experienced traders. Common issues include overloading the platform with too many concurrent automated strategies (Expert Advisors), leading to latency or mismanagement of trades. Also problematic is inadequate prioritization of tasks which can result in significant slippage or missed trade opportunities during volatile market conditions.The consequences of inefficient task dispatching range from diminished returns due to delayed order execution to increased risks if stop-loss orders are not managed promptly. Ultimately, these inefficiencies can degrade overall trading performance and erode confidence in one’s trading approach.
Strategies for Optimizing Task Management in MetaTrader 5
To harness the full potential of MT5’s task management capabilities, traders should consider implementing effective methods such as automation features for routine tasks and prioritizing operations based on their critical nature.Automation through the use of Expert Advisors can help streamline repetitive tasks like opening or closing positions at specific market conditions, while scripts can perform batch operations more efficiently than manual execution.
Traders can utilize built-in tools like the Strategy Tester to backtest their automated strategies under different market conditions before deploying them live. Moreover, custom scripts developed using MQL5 programming language allow for tailoring task execution processes according to individual needs.
